Goto~lbl (unbedingter sprung), Isz (bedingter sprung) – Casio fx-9750GA PLUS Benutzerhandbuch

Seite 213

Advertising
background image

8-5-7

Befehlsreferenz

Goto~Lbl (Unbedingter Sprung)

Funktion: Dieser Befehl führt einen unbedingten Sprung zu einer markierten Stelle aus.

Syntax: Goto <Wert oder Variable> ~ Lbl <Wert oder Variable>

Parameter: Wert (0 bis 9), Variable (A bis Z,

r

,

θ )

Beschreibung:

• Dieser Befehl besteht aus zwei Teilen: Goto

n

(Wo

n

ein Wert von 0 bis 9 ist) und Lbl

n

(Wo

n

der Wert für die Goto-Anweisung ist). Dieser Befehl sorgt dafür, dass die Ausführung

des Programms zu der Lbl-Anweisung springt, deren Wert dem in der Goto-Anweisung
angegebenen Wert entspricht.

• Dieser Befehl kann verwendet werden, um z.B. eine Schleife zurück an den Beginn der

Schleife zu bilden oder um an eine beliebige Stelle innerhalb des Programms zu springen.

• Dieser Befehl kann in Kombination mit bedingten Sprüngen und Zählungssprüngen

verwendet werden.

• Falls keine Lbl-Anweisung vorhanden ist, deren Wert mit dem Wert der Goto-Anweisung

übereinstimmt, kommt es zu einer Fehlermeldung.

Isz (Bedingter Sprung)

Funktion: Dieser Befehl ist ein Zählungssprung, der den Wert einer Steuervariablen um 1
vergrößert. Der Sprung wird ausführt, wenn der aktuelle Wert der Steuervariablen Null ist.

Syntax:

Variablenwert G 0

Isz <Variablenname> : <Anweisung>

_

:

^

<Anweisung>

Variablenwert = 0

Parameter: Variablenname: A bis Z,

r

,

θ

[Beispiel] Isz A : Vergrößert den der Variablen A zugeordneten Wert um 1.

Beschreibung: Dieser Befehl vergrößert den Wert einer Steuervariablen um 1 und prüft
diesen danach. Falls der aktuelle Wert nicht Null ist, setzt die Programmausführung mit der
nächsten Anweisung fort. Falls der aktuelle Wert Null ist, springt die Programmausführung
an die Anweisung, die dem Mehrfachanweisungsbefehl (:), Anzeigebefehl (

^) oder

Neuzeilenbefehl (

_) folgt.

Advertising